Sam Younger named chief operating officer at TriStar Summit Medical Center

Hermitage, Tenn. — TriStar Summit Medical Center, part of HCA Healthcare, announced today that Sam Younger has been named chief operating officer, effective June 1.

Younger joins TriStar Summit with extensive experience in healthcare leadership, clinical operations and hospital growth. Most recently, he served as chief operating officer at TriStar Greenview Regional Hospital, where he led significant expansion across cardiology, general surgery, vascular surgery and critical care services. He also played an instrumental role in opening the first freestanding emergency room in Bowling Green, Kentucky.

“We are thrilled to welcome Sam to TriStar Summit Medical Center,” said Cindy Bergmeier, chief executive officer of TriStar Summit Medical Center. “He brings strong operational experience, a collaborative leadership style and a clear commitment to patient-centered care. I look forward to the positive impact he will make as we continue strengthening physician partnerships, supporting our colleagues and delivering high-quality care to patients and families across Davidson, Wilson and surrounding counties.”

Younger received a bachelor’s and a master’s degree in healthcare administration from Western Kentucky University. He also earned a Master’s of Nursing from Vanderbilt University and is licensed as an adult-gerontology nurse practitioner. He holds a doctorate in healthcare innovation from Arizona State University.
